Read MoreIndustrial circuit breakers operate in environments where electrical loads fluctuate constantly and fault conditions can develop within milliseconds. Manufacturing lines, heavy machinery systems, and automated production facilities require protective devices that tolerate high fault currents while maintaining stable interruption capability. In these scenarios, the internal arc-extinguishing structure, contact materials, and thermal-magnetic calibration accuracy determine whether a breaker can respond correctly during short circuits or overload conditions.
Industrial systems often involve motors, pumps, compressors, and variable frequency drives that produce inrush currents several times higher than normal operating current. Selecting industrial circuit breakers therefore involves evaluating not only rated current but also breaking capacity, mechanical durability, and coordination with upstream protection equipment. Manufacturers that specialize in circuit breaker engineering focus heavily on contact alloy composition, arc chute design, and magnetic tripping precision to ensure reliable interruption under repeated fault events.

Residential circuit breakers operate in a completely different electrical environment compared with industrial installations. Household distribution panels supply lighting circuits, kitchen appliances, air conditioning units, and electronic devices, each presenting different load characteristics. Rather than handling extremely high fault currents, residential breakers must prioritize consistent sensitivity to moderate overloads and electrical faults that could lead to wiring damage or fire hazards.
Modern homes contain a growing number of high-power electrical appliances such as induction cooktops, electric water heaters, and electric vehicle charging equipment. This change in load profile has increased the importance of selecting circuit breakers with precise tripping curves and stable thermal protection characteristics. Properly calibrated residential circuit breakers protect branch circuits without nuisance tripping while still disconnecting power when abnormal current persists.
| Load Category | Typical Electrical Behavior | Breaker Protection Consideration |
| Lighting circuits | Low continuous current with occasional switching surges | Stable thermal response with moderate short-circuit protection |
| Kitchen appliances | High power consumption with intermittent operation | Accurate overload protection to prevent cable overheating |
| Air conditioners | Compressor startup current several times rated current | Magnetic trip tolerance for temporary inrush current |
| Electric vehicle chargers | Long-duration high current charging cycles | Stable thermal calibration for continuous loads |
With the increasing electrification of residential infrastructure, circuit breaker manufacturers are placing greater emphasis on long-term thermal stability, consistent tripping performance, and compatibility with compact distribution boards used in modern housing construction.
Commercial buildings such as office complexes, shopping centers, hospitals, and hotels require electrical protection systems that balance operational reliability with energy management efficiency. Commercial circuit breakers must support large distribution panels that supply multiple floors, lighting systems, elevators, HVAC equipment, and information technology infrastructure.
One of the key challenges in commercial power distribution is maintaining selectivity between upstream and downstream protective devices. When a fault occurs in a single branch circuit, only the nearest breaker should trip while upstream devices remain closed. This selective coordination reduces power interruptions across the building and prevents unnecessary downtime for tenants and facility operators.
